TEZPUR: In view of the rising COVID cases in Sonitpur district, Deputy Commissioner-cum-chairman, DDMA Sonitpur, Manvendra Pratap Singh in exercise of powers conferred under section 30 (2) (v), (xviii), (xx) and 34 (c), (h), (j), (m) of Disaster Management Act, 2005, has declared that all weekly and bi-weekly markets of Sonitpur District to remain closed till May 31, 2021. This order will come into force with immediate effect.

BISWANATH CHARIALI: The District Magistrate and Chairman, District Disaster Management Authority, Biswanath has ordered the closure of all weekly and bi-weekly markets and haats under Biswanath district w.e.f from Tuesday for the maintenance of public health, hygiene and safety of the general public in exercise of the power conferred upon under Section 34(¢), 34(m) of Disaster Management Act, 2005. This order came into force with immediate effect and will remain in force until further order. This order came after the detection of a large number of COVID-19 positive cases in Biswanath district.

Any persons violating these measures will be liable to be proceeded against as per the provisions of the Act besides legal action or penalty as per IPC and other legal provisions, as applicable. The District Magistrate and Chairman, District Disaster Management Authority, Biswanath, Pranab Kumar Sarmah informed that there was every possibility of huge gathering in the weekly and bi-weekly markets and haats under Biswanath district which might lead to spread of COVID-19. Therefore, considering the present scenario, emergent steps were required to be taken to contain the spread of COVID-19 in the district, he said.
